December 28, 2021Video of Shooting on 68th Street in Bay Ridge – Suspects Still on the Loose
There was a shooting on December 21st at 12:55 am at 308 68th Street in Bay Ridge. (Info here)
The perps approached a 33-year-old man with a gun and shot him in the leg in the apartment vestibule.
The suspects fled in a white vehicle and are still on the loose. (Source) It’s strange that we have to get information from Bronx News because the precinct and politicians aren’t sharing any information.

December 27, 202162nd Precinct Detectives Arrest Man Who Killed Ilya Ifraimov in Brooklyn in April

Today Commissioner Shea announced that the 62nd Precinct Detectives followed Ilya Ifraimov’s killer to Florida and have now charged him with murder.
Ilya Ifraimov was a 30-year-old Brooklyn man killed around the corner from his home. He was stabbed in the chest on Bath Avenue and Bay Parkway.

December 27, 2021College Was Student Attacked on 86th Street in Bay Ridge For Wearing IDF Sweatshirt
On Sunday, December 26th, Blake Zavadsky and Ilan Kaganovich went to Foot Locker on 86th Street in Bay Ridge.

The college students waited outside the store because it wasn’t open yet. (Source)
Zavadsky was wearing a hoodie with the IDF, the Israeli military hooded sweatshirt, which angered another man. The man told him to take off the sweatshirt.
When Zavadsky didn’t comply he was punched outside of Footlocker on 86th Street.
The employees at Footlocker didn’t help – Blake asked one for a napkin because his face was bleeding. They didn’t give him a napkin. (Source)
Zavadsky has a black eye in the photos in the newspaper. See here
The Anti-Defamation League has offered $5000 for information leading to the arrest and conviction of people responsible for this act. If you know anything, you can report it here.
The police are looking for this alleged perpetrator.

It’s being investigated as a hate crime. It’s awful that people are experiencing antisemitism as they are shopping in the area.
